Home | History | Annotate | Download | only in pipes

Lines Matching refs:ctrl

58     if(!mCtrlData.ctrl.init(fbNum)) {
59 ALOGE("GenericPipe failed to init ctrl");
74 if(!mCtrlData.ctrl.close()) {
75 ALOGE("GenericPipe failed to close ctrl");
89 mCtrlData.ctrl.setSource(args);
93 mCtrlData.ctrl.setCrop(d);
97 mCtrlData.ctrl.setTransform(orient);
101 mCtrlData.ctrl.setPosition(d);
106 return mCtrlData.ctrl.setVisualParams(metadata);
114 ovutils::Dim src(mCtrlData.ctrl.getCrop());
115 ovutils::Dim dst(mCtrlData.ctrl.getPosition());
120 mCtrlData.ctrl.setDownscale(downscale_factor);
121 ret = mCtrlData.ctrl.commit();
128 //TODO Move pipe-id transfer to CtrlData class. Make ctrl and data private.
130 int pipeId = mCtrlData.ctrl.getPipeId();
131 OVASSERT(-1 != pipeId, "Ctrl ID should not be -1");
132 // set pipe id from ctrl to data
139 return mCtrlData.ctrl.getFd();
144 return mCtrlData.ctrl.getCrop();
151 mCtrlData.ctrl.dump();
158 mCtrlData.ctrl.getDump(buf, len);
176 mCtrlData.ctrl.forceSet();